# Break-Glass: Catalog Cache Invalidation

Scope: the Pinrow product catalog at Veldstone Retail. If stale prices persist after a purge and the Hollowmere invalidation queue is wedged, use break-glass to flush the edge tier directly. Contractors: get verbal sign-off from the catalog lead first. Steps: open the Hollowmere admin shell, select emergency-flush, confirm the tenant, and run it once — repeated flushes thrash the origin. Access is logged and expires after 20 minutes. Unseal the admin shell with the passphrase below.

recovery phrase for kahop-tajog: istix-casvan

## Matchline GC Pauses

Matchline (our order-matching service) runs on the JVM with ZGC. Pauses over 40ms trip the latency SLO, so we cap heap at 12GB and pin the matcher threads. Do not enable heap dumps in prod — the pause alone breaks matching. If you change GC flags, redeploy via the Tarn pipeline only. Signed builds are mandatory; the pipeline verifies against the key below.

release key, yahif-kajeg: bky19_YSG492TE1CUe938KkHv

Runbook: GarageGlance occupancy feed

If the Harborview Deck occupancy feed goes stale (no updates for 5+ minutes), first check the sensor gateway health page. Green but stale usually means the aggregator queue is backed up; restart the aggregator via the ops console and counts should recover within two minutes. If spots show negative numbers, force a full recount from the camera snapshots. When escalating to engineering, include the trace token shown below.

session token of yawif-kahof = htk9_dd6996ed6